Beads Out Level 114 Walkthrough
Beads Out Level 114 is a vertical oval ring over a simple lower pocket. Work the lower sides and top band first, shorten the small upper pipes second, and then let the reserve singles and boxed blockers disappear after the spout quiets down.

How to Solve Beads Out Level 114 — Full Solution
- Clear the blue-yellow lower-left side and the green-brown right side of the oval ring.
- Trim the pink top band and the short upper pipes while the reserve stays mostly untouched.
- Let the oval become smaller before the lower pocket starts clearing whole rows.
- Use the boxed blockers only after the shell has already stopped feeding the center.
- Finish with the last isolated singles once the ring is down to its final short lap.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Opening the lower pocket while the oval still has a full heavy lap.
- Ignoring the short upper pipes and leaving extra pressure on the center spout.

Board notes 5 details
- Layout
- The board is a vertical oval ring under two short top pipes. The reserve below is a tidy pocket of loose singles and a few boxed blockers, with no long countdown chain.
- Goal
- Shrink the oval before the lower pocket begins clearing in earnest.
- Opening
- Start on the blue-yellow lower-left side of the oval and the green-brown right side, then trim the pink top band and the small upper pipes.
- Danger Zone
- The reserve narrows at the exact point where the oval drains, so the boxed blockers clog the center if the shell is still carrying a full lap.
- Mechanics
- Level 114 is a cleaner shell-management stage where timing the simple reserve matters more than any gadget.
